3WL Air Circuit Breakers
3WL air circuit breakers/non-automatic air circuit breakers up to 6300 A (AC), IEC
CubicleBUS modules
Digital output module with rotary coding switch
6 items of binary information concerning the state of the circuit
breaker (reasons for tripping and warnings) can be output via
this module to external signaling devices (e.g. LED, horn) or
used for the selective shutdown of other system components
(e.g. frequency converters).
Digital output modules are available in versions with and without
a rotary coding switch. On modules with a rotary coding switch
it is possible to choose between two signaling blocks each with
6 defined assignments and to set an additional response delay.
All the digital output modules are available as a version with
relay outputs (CO contacts, up to 12 A). Up to two modules
of this type can be connected to one 3WL circuit breaker.

Digital output module, configurable
The configurable output module is available for higher-perfor-
mance solutions. With this module, random events on the
CubicleBUS can be switched directly to one of six available
outputs or three of these outputs can be assigned with up
to six events. In other words, up to six events can be placed
on one physical output with OR operation. Either BDA Plus or
powerconfig are used for configuring.
A relay variant is also available here the same as for the output
modules with rotary coding switch. Only one module of this type
is possible per 3WL circuit breaker.

Digital input modules
With the digital input module, up to 6 additional binary signals
(24 V DC) in the circuit breaker environment can be connected
to the system. It is thus possible for example to send messages
concerning the state of a switch disconnector or a control
cabinet door to the PROFIBUS DP/MODBUS.
With the digital input module on the CubicleBUS it is also
possible for the two different protection parameter sets held
in the ETU76B E trip unit to be switched over automatically
in a few milliseconds. It is thus possible, for example, to
automatically change the parameters of a coupling switch
should the transformer infeed fail.
One module each of this type can be used for holding the six
items of digital information and for automatically switching over
the parameters.

ZSI module (short-time discrimination control)
The use of ZSI modules is recommended when Siemens circuit
breakers are arranged in several staggered levels but full
discrimination with the smallest possible delay is to be assured
nevertheless.
The circuit breakers are interconnected by these modules.
In case of a short-circuit, each affected circuit breaker
interrogates the circuit breakers directly downstream whether
the short-circuit has also occurred in the next, lower level.
The short-circuit is exactly localized as a result, and only the
next upstream circuit breaker in the energy flow direction is
switched off.
